Washington State Market Access Program announced

The DMAA is organizing a Market Access Program focused on Seattle, Washington from July 16 to 19, 2007. The program is aimed at Alberta-based digital media companies in the areas of web technologies, interactive design, and online game development, that are looking to do business with companies in the Washington State region. Washington State is a global leader in digital media development, with one of the largest concentrations of companies in the world.

Mixer: How Voodoo Computers Became Part of HP

On March 19, join Rahul Sood, Director and Chief Technology Officer of HP's Gaming PC business unit in Calgary. He'll speak about how a dropout from Mount Royal College started a computer company (Voodoo Computers) that started building custom-built PCs for business and became focused on building high-end high-performance PCs for gamers. The business grew to the point where Voodoo attracted the attention of Hewlett-Packard, which in 2006 bought the company, to become part of its Personal Systems Group. This mixer is presented by the Digital Media Association of Alberta.
